Our
Mission:
In
support of Three Rivers Community College's mission and
purpose as stated in the college catalog, the Learning
Resource Centers provide a well-organized collection of
high-quality materials and services in an efficient, fiscally
responsible and timely manner. The ultimate goal of the
Learning Resource Centers is to instruct and prepare users to
be life-long learners.

General
Information:
Both
sites contain books, periodicals, pamphlets, and audiovisual
materials for use by both the College community and the
general public. As a
member of the NEW and IMPROVED Online Catalog Libris,
(Library Resources Information System for Connecticut
Community Colleges) students, faculty, staff and the community
now have 24 hour access to the catalog seven days a week via
the World Wide Web.
The
Learning Resource Centers offer instructional programs on
using the library, audiovisual materials, conducting research
and writing term papers.
Instruction is available for both groups and
individuals upon request.
The Library Instruction program is emphasized so that the
Learning Resource Center is also a teaching unit in the
college, which will provide an unlimited interdisciplinary
approach to knowledge. Its purpose is to help create a richer
learning environment in which students learn to do independent
study with individualized instruction. In addition, the
Learning Resource Centers provide computers and audiovisual
equipment for general use.
